Why "Rotation5"
Four rotations taught us to swim. The fifth, we jumped on our own.
Rotation5 takes its name from PayPal's Technology Leadership Program — four six-month rotations built to forge the company's next generation of leaders. My cofounder Priya Rajendran and I were in the inaugural class of nine.
In April 2017 we gave ourselves a fifth rotation: no cohort, no corporation, no safety net — just a self-imposed six months to build something that mattered. Curiosity gave the start, necessity kept us focused, and the network we'd built kept us afloat.
"We were in the middle of the ocean, and this time, we jumped voluntarily."
That rotation became S'moresUp — and the operating instinct behind everything I've built since. Today I apply that same founder-level judgment to AI-native products, platforms, and teams.
